In₂Pb₂Cl₆ is a mixed-metal halide semiconductor compound combining indium and lead chlorides, belonging to the family of layered perovskite and non-perovskite halide semiconductors. This is primarily a research-stage material investigated for optoelectronic applications, particularly in photovoltaics and light-emitting devices, where its tunable bandgap and potential for solution processing offer advantages over conventional semiconductors. The material is notable within the halide perovskite research community because lead-tin or lead-indium combinations can provide improved stability or reduced toxicity compared to pure lead halides, though commercialization remains limited.
